Description of key information
EC50 (72 h): 0.179 mg/L (geom. mean)
EC10 (72 h): 0.0994 mg/L (geom. mean)
Key value for chemical safety assessment
Additional information
The key study investigating the toxicity Alcohols, C12-13, branched and linear, ethoxylated to aquatic algae was conducted according to OECD 201. In the GLP guideline study the growth inhibition of green algae (Raphidocelis subcapitata) at nominal test item concentrations of 0.0750, 0.150, 0.300, 0.600, 1.20 mg/L was monitored. The test concentrations were analytically monitored by HPLC-MS/MS. The time weighted mean measured concentrations, based on three representative constituents of the UVCB substance, were 0.0165, 0.0435, 0.0960, 0.288, 0.516 mg/L. Based on the algal growth rate an EC50 (72 h) of 0.179 mg/L (geom. mean) was observed. The determined EC10 (72 h) was 0.0994 mg/L (geom. mean).
